John Scalisi work experience

A career timeline built from the work history available for this profile.

Software Engineer

Current

Cambridge, Massachusetts, United States

Software Engineer for the Archive Development team for the Chandra X-Ray Observatory Center, assisting in the archival and retrieval of observation data. Responsible for design, implementation, and testing of web-based applications and services. Other responsibilities include implementing Perl scripts and Database Stored-Procedures to assist internal groups with data access and management, application component and database upgrades, and diagnosis recurring system issues.

Apr 2021 - Present

Senior Software Engineer

Greater Boston Area

Software engineer for the Artifact Management (AMS) and TIBCO ModelOps servers, Angular/Jetty based client-servers that helps to manage and deploy Models used by Event Flow processing applications. Responsible for design, implementation, and testing of the AMS/ModelOps server-side, including database schema design and migration (H2 and PostgreSQL databases), Ebeans ORM entities and data access objects (DAOs), REST-APIs, and service layers. Other responsibilities include implementing a Shiro Realm for the TIBCO Cloud using JSON Web Tokens (JWTs), using Maven/Docker to build Docker Images of the AMS/ModelOps servers, and Technical Lead of the Web UI, QA, and Documentation members of the AMS project team.
